President of Turkmenistan Gurbanguly Berdimuhamedov arrived in Tajikistan on an official visit
DUSHANBE, 02.11.2017 /NIAT “Khovar”/. President of Turkmenistan Gurbanguly Berdimuhamedov arrived in Tajikistan on a two-day official visit.
The Prime Minister of Tajikistan Qohir Rasulzoda, Mayor of Dushanbe city Rustami Emomali and other officials, greeted the distinguished guest at the Dushanbe International Airport.
During the visit, President of Turkmenistan Gurbanguly Berdimuhamedov will hold talks with the President of Tajikistan Emomali Rahmon.
It should be noted that this is the fourth official visit of Gurbanguly Berdimuhamedov to Tajikistan in the past 9 years of his presidency.
More than 50 documents were signed between the two countries on cooperation in various fields over 22 years The trade turnover between the two states last year amounted to 93 million US dollars.
